Babylon, NY to Greenville, NY is 163.7 miles and takes about 3h 32m via NY 17, with a fuel budget near $27 and enough daylight to finish in a day. This trip is a straightforward drive, primarily on highways, making it a convenient option for a single-day journey. You'll be staying within New York State for the entire duration, moving from the Northeast region to another part of the Northeast. Given its relatively short length and highway focus, this route is ideal if you're looking for an efficient way to cover ground without extensive planning.

Seasonal Notes
Summer travel usually means heavier construction, hotter rest stops, and busier weekend traffic around major cities.
Winter travel shortens daylight, so a route that looks manageable on paper can feel much longer after dark.
Holiday weekends tend to make both departure and arrival windows slower than the raw route time suggests.
